Andrew P. Botti to Present on the Non-Compete Legal Landscape in Massachusetts in 2014

The McLane Law Firm is pleased to announce that Andrew P. Botti, a Director in the firm’s Litigation Department, will be the featured speaker at McLane’s Conference Center in Woburn, MA on Tuesday, February 25, 2014, at 8 a.m. on the non-compete legal landscape facing employers in 2014.
 
As former Chairman of the Smaller Business Association of New England or SBANE, and a practicing attorney for over 22 years, Mr. Botti brings a unique perspective to recent legislative and judicial approaches to post-employment restrictive covenants, and the present extent of their enforceability.

A copy of Mr. Botti’s précis entitled “Employee Duty of Loyalty,” will be made available to attendees.
